One month in...

So we're a month into this experiment, 43 tournaments played so far. While I am still ahead $8.89, I am down over a dollar compared to my 2-week status. I have cashed just twice - both times in 6th place - over my last 14 tournaments. I've taken so many ridiculous bad beats over the last run of tournaments that I've begun to expect to get knocked out and that's bad. I've been busted four times in the last 20 tournaments while holding AA - by 10/10, 4/5, 2/3, and Q/6. I've dropped to cashing only 28% of the time and now have an average finish of just worse than 16th place. Not at all what I want or was expecting. Still, I'm ahead $8.89 and that's a good thing - that's an 83% profit on every single tournament I've played (43 tourneys, $8.89 profit = 20.67 cents per tournament. 25-cent buy-in each time = 83% profit per tournament). So the overall totals are fine but, man, the recent results are very depressing. I continually get punished for making the correct play and that's tough to take. All I can do is keep slogging away knowing that the correct play will eventually get rewarded.
